Understanding Calcium's Role in the Body

Calcium is a vital mineral, playing a crucial role not only in building strong bones and teeth but also in nerve function, muscle contraction, and blood clotting. Many people take calcium supplements to ensure they meet their daily needs, especially to prevent or manage osteoporosis. However, concerns have been raised about how these supplements might affect cardiovascular health, particularly regarding arterial plaque formation, which is a key marker of atherosclerosis.

The Dietary Calcium vs. Supplemental Calcium Debate

While a lifelong diet rich in calcium from foods like dairy and leafy greens is linked to lower cardiovascular risk, the evidence for calcium supplements is more complex. This difference may be due to how the body absorbs and processes calcium depending on its source. When consumed through food, calcium is absorbed slowly and steadily throughout the day. In contrast, supplements often deliver a large, concentrated dose of calcium at once, leading to a rapid spike in blood calcium levels. This rapid increase is suspected of potentially contributing to arterial calcification.

Key Research Findings on Calcium Supplements and Arterial Plaque

Several prominent studies have investigated the link between calcium intake and arterial plaque. The results, however, are not unanimous, adding to the controversy surrounding this topic.

Multi-Ethnic Study of Atherosclerosis (MESA)

A decade-long study from Johns Hopkins Medicine, which involved over 2,700 participants, found that taking calcium supplements was associated with a 22% increased risk of developing plaque buildup in the heart arteries over 10 years. Importantly, the study also found that those with the highest dietary calcium intake had a lower risk of developing atherosclerosis. The researchers noted that while the study showed an association, it did not prove cause and effect.

Randomised Controlled Trials (RCTs) and Meta-Analyses

Early meta-analyses, such as one from 2010 published in The BMJ, showed that calcium supplements (without co-administered vitamin D) were associated with a roughly 30% increase in the risk of myocardial infarction. However, more recent meta-analyses have presented conflicting results. A 2023 review of RCTs found no significant association between calcium supplementation and major cardiovascular events, including myocardial infarction and stroke. This highlights the need for further, focused research.

How Supplements Might Increase Risk

  • Acute Hypercalcemia: The surge in blood calcium levels following supplement ingestion may overstimulate processes that lead to calcium deposition in the artery walls.
  • Impact on Plaque: A 2021 study in the journal Atherosclerosis found that oral calcium supplements were associated with increased calcium deposition in coronary arteries, independent of changes in atheroma volume.
  • Vitamin D's Role: Some studies suggest that the co-administration of vitamin D with calcium does not mitigate the cardiovascular risks associated with calcium supplements.

Dietary Calcium vs. Supplemental Calcium: A Comparison

To highlight the difference in approaches to meeting calcium needs, the following table compares dietary calcium sources with calcium supplements.

Feature Dietary Calcium Calcium Supplements
Source Dairy products (milk, yogurt, cheese), leafy greens (kale, spinach), fortified foods, fish with bones (sardines). Pills, chews, liquids containing calcium salts like carbonate or citrate.
Absorption Rate Slow and steady, as calcium is mixed with food and absorbed gradually over time. Rapid, creating a sudden spike in blood calcium levels.
Cardiovascular Risk Generally considered protective or neutral, especially at recommended intake levels. Potential for increased risk of arterial plaque formation and cardiovascular events, especially with high doses.
Nutrient Synergy Comes naturally with other beneficial nutrients like Vitamin K2 and magnesium. Often isolated, lacking the synergistic benefits found in whole foods.
Side Effects Typically minimal for most people. Possible side effects like constipation, gas, or bloating.

Reducing Potential Risks and Making Informed Choices

For those concerned about the link between calcium supplements and arterial plaque, several strategies can help minimize risks. Prioritizing dietary calcium is the most widely recommended approach, as food sources are processed differently and are linked to better cardiovascular outcomes. If supplements are necessary, such as for individuals with specific deficiencies or health conditions, consulting a healthcare provider is essential. They can determine the right dosage and form of supplement to minimize potential risks.

Here are some proactive steps individuals can take:

  • Focus on Diet First: Consume calcium-rich foods regularly. This includes dairy, fortified plant-based milks, dark leafy greens, and sardines. Always aim for a varied diet to meet your nutritional needs.
  • Assess Your Needs: Talk to your doctor to understand your personal calcium requirements. This is particularly important for postmenopausal women and those with osteoporosis.
  • Mind the Dosage: If you need a supplement, consider taking smaller doses throughout the day instead of a large single dose. This can help prevent the abrupt spikes in blood calcium levels.
  • Check for Vitamin D: Ensure adequate vitamin D levels, as vitamin D is essential for proper calcium absorption. Your doctor can help determine if a supplement is needed.

Conclusion: A Balanced Perspective

The question, "Can taking calcium supplements cause plaque in arteries?", involves nuance and ongoing scientific debate. While dietary calcium is consistently linked to better or neutral cardiovascular health outcomes, some research points to a potential link between calcium supplements and an increased risk of arterial plaque buildup. The discrepancy seems to stem from how the body processes the different forms of calcium. Bolus doses from supplements may lead to sudden, high spikes in blood calcium, which can potentially promote vascular calcification. Given the mixed evidence and the potential risks associated with high-dose supplementation, experts recommend prioritizing calcium from dietary sources whenever possible. Consulting with a healthcare provider is the safest way to determine if a supplement is necessary for your health needs, ensuring a balanced approach that supports both bone and heart health.
